Animal chiropractors serving Charleston typically hold certifications such as AVCA (American Veterinary Chiropractic Association) or IVCA (International Veterinary Chiropractic Association), ensuring advanced training in anatomy, biomechanics, and safe, low-force adjustment techniques.

💡 What to Expect During an Animal Chiropractic Session
An animal chiropractic session in Charleston typically begins with a full evaluation of posture, gait, and range of motion. Providers observe how your pet moves in real-world conditions, including common household flooring and outdoor surfaces reflective of Charleston’s historic and coastal environment.
Gentle, highly controlled adjustments are then applied to areas of restriction in the spine or joints. These techniques are low-force and tailored to the animal’s species, size, and comfort level.
Most pets respond well to care, and many owners notice gradual improvements in mobility, flexibility, and overall comfort with consistent sessions.

💰 Animal Chiropractic Pricing in Charleston, SC
In Charleston, pricing for animal chiropractic care typically varies based on provider certification, visit type, and whether care is delivered in-home or in-clinic. Initial consultations with first adjustments generally range from $75 to $175, while follow-up sessions often fall between $60 and $150. Mobile and wellness packages are commonly available for pets requiring ongoing mobility support.
Many pet parents choose structured care plans for senior pets or active animals that benefit from consistent maintenance throughout the year.

Are animal chiropractors in Charleston safe for dogs and cats? Yes. Certified animal chiropractors use gentle, species-specific techniques designed for safety and comfort. Most providers are trained through AVCA or IVCA certification programs and often coordinate with veterinarians when needed.

Do I need a veterinarian referral before booking? Not always. However, veterinary coordination is recommended for pets with medical conditions, chronic issues, or recent surgeries.
